Jump to content
  • Sign Up

Switch74

Expert
  • Posts

    3,207
  • Joined

  • Last visited

  • Days Won

    146

Community Answers

  1. Switch74
    Switch74's post in Сворачивание меню при нажатии на ссылку was marked as the answer   
    можно попробовать такой вариант, но он может не подойти для мобилок, но если подзаморочиться, то можно и для них сделать
    https://jsfiddle.net/6keucgnt/

    самый простой способ при клике на ссылку через js имитировать клик по крестику
    а .mask-content можно сделать label
  2. Switch74
    Switch74's post in Занесение чекбоксов в БД was marked as the answer   
    1. в html вы отметили правильный ответ, что для опросника/теста на мой взгляд очень не очень :)
    2. в вашем случае достаточно было бы
     
    mysql_connect("localhost", "user", "password"); mysql_select_db('olala') or die(mysql_error()); if(isset($_GET['submit'])) { $insert = ''; foreach($_GET['formDoor'] as $key=>$val) { if(!empty($insert)) $insert .= ','; $insert .= '("'.$val.'")'; } $insert = 'INSERT INTO `table_one` (`name`) VALUES '.$insert; mysql_query($sql_1) or die(mysql_error()); }  
  3. Switch74
    Switch74's post in Убрать часть url was marked as the answer   
    window.location.pathname.substr(3)  
  4. Switch74
    Switch74's post in Оформить как ссылку was marked as the answer   
    <a id="demo"></a> <script> document.getElementById("demo").href= "http://site.ru/ru/" + window.location.pathname; </script>
     
  5. Switch74
    Switch74's post in Вкладки с динамической подгрузкой was marked as the answer   
    суть вкладок такая же может быть,
    код скрипта нужно править, сейчас все вкладки у вас будут подгружать один и тот же iframe
     
    <span class="address-link" data-target-id="target-div" data-target="http://site.ru/page1/">вкладка1</span> <span class="address-link" data-target-id="target-div" data-target="http://site.ru/page2/">вкладка2</span> <div id="target-div"></div>  
    $('.address-link').click(function(){    var targetId = $(this).data('target-id');    var target = $(this).data('target');    $('#' + targetId).html('<iframe src="'+target +'"></iframe>');  });
    Не понятно что за скрипты вы планируете грузить, по сути ни чего не мешает грузить скрипты, и даже iframe через скрипты
  6. Switch74
    Switch74's post in работа кнопок с условием ЕСЛИ was marked as the answer   
    http://jsfiddle.net/bnrx8a19/
  7. Switch74
    Switch74's post in Появление лишнего отступа в блоке was marked as the answer   
    для ссылок добавьте vertical-align: top
  8. Switch74
    Switch74's post in Прижать таблицу к верхней части контейнера was marked as the answer   
    для <div class="box sidebar">
    укажите vertical-align: top;
       
  9. Switch74
    Switch74's post in особый вид элемента на Flexbox was marked as the answer   
    http://jsfiddle.net/68eov90r/
  10. Switch74
    Switch74's post in <!DOCTYPE html>  was marked as the answer   
    display:block; прописан для article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section
    линия у вас img
  11. Switch74
    Switch74's post in Хитро убрать pointer-events со ссылки и вернуть обратно was marked as the answer   
    а оно у вас так и должно скакать?
    вы вроде говорили что меняется цвет текста только
    что именно вам нужно сделать?
    могу пока наванговать только что-то вроде:
    http://jsfiddle.net/umd0y4L9/
  12. Switch74
    Switch74's post in Отправка заявки на почту was marked as the answer   
    $from = '[email protected] (mail.net)';     $date = new DateTime();     $headers = '';     $mail = '[email protected]';     $subject = '=?utf-8?B?'.base64_encode('заголовок').'?=';     $text = 'текст';     $headers .= 'Content-Transfer-Encoding: utf-8'."\r\n";     $headers .= 'Content-type:text/html; Charset=utf8'."\r\n";     $headers .= 'From: '.$from."\r\n";     $headers .= 'Reply-To: '.$from."\r\n";     $headers .= 'Precedence: bulk'."\r\n";     $headers .= 'Date: '.$date->format(DateTime::RFC2822)."\r\n";     $result = mail($mail, $subject, $text, $headers,'-f'.$from); Вот рабочий вариант, если не приходит на mail.ru, то нужно смотреть как настроена отправка почты у вас на сервере
  13. Switch74
    Switch74's post in Закрывающийся/открывающийся блок was marked as the answer   
    Можно попробовать вот так
    http://jsfiddle.net/yhzduj7o/
    еще можно через js там возможно будет что-то попроще :)
  14. Switch74
    Switch74's post in Как заставить box-shadow перекрывать контент? was marked as the answer   
    если вы про меню которое выдвигается слева, то у него box-shadow:none
  15. Switch74
    Switch74's post in Не совсем догоняю про поддержку браузерами, объясните пожалуйста. was marked as the answer   
    Основные разработчики браузеров стараются придерживаться спецификации, но у каждого бывает возникают: ошибки не доработки (как раз из-за особенностей движка). Т.к. все браузеры делают одно и то же, но разными способами у всех есть свои сильные и слабые стороны. Мобильные браузеры урезаны в функционале и в первую очередь предназначены для отображения простой мобильной верстки, но со своим функционалом, бывает некоторые функции для ускорения работы убираются, а некоторые для управления добавляются. Экспериментируют с новыми функциями все разработчики. 
  16. Switch74
    Switch74's post in Блоки на одном уровне was marked as the answer   
    Сделайте блок с заголовком на 50% по высоте и выравнивайте текст внутри по нижнему краю
    я бы просто поделил ваш .features-item__content пополам вертикально в верхнем блоке заголовок по нижнему краю, в нижнем кнопка по верхнему
  17. Switch74
    Switch74's post in Небольшой отступ от логотипа was marked as the answer   
    измените размеры картинки под высоту вашего блока
  18. Switch74
    Switch74's post in Проблема с позиционированием was marked as the answer   
    https://jsfiddle.net/gryrs9tq/15/
  19. Switch74
    Switch74's post in Подскажите как сверстать блок меню с логотипом в центре was marked as the answer   
    https://jsfiddle.net/e925yfyw/13/
  20. Switch74
    Switch74's post in Несколько js на одной html странице was marked as the answer   
    Тут можно было обойтись одним скриптом, т.к. функции у вас по сути одинаковые можно переделать их по аналогии:
     
    function setPost(send) {     xhr = new XMLHttpRequest();     xhr.open("POST", 'cgi-bin/getVars.py', true);     xhr.setRequestHeader('Content-type', 'application/json; charset=utf-8')     xhr.onreadystatechange = onResponse;     xhr.send(send); } Вызывать такую функцию можно так:
     
    var timerPost = setInterval(function(){setPost(send)}, 100); Если у вас единовременно показывается только одна svg, а другая скрыта, анимировать обе смысла нет - бессмысленно нагружаете систему, можно вызывать функцию анимации при открытии вкладки, на вкладке можно держать data-send в котором и будет хранится нужная вам информация которую потом можно было бы использовать в функциях
    setInterval тогда будет один для анимации одного svg
    Иначе, если вам нужно анимировать сразу два svg, то можно использовать массив, например anim_svg[]
    в котором можно хранить ваши 0 и 49 со всеми нужными данными
  21. Switch74
    Switch74's post in Откуда берется картинка, когда даешь ссылку на сайт? was marked as the answer   
    https://yandex.ru/support/webmaster/open-graph/intro-open-graph.xml
  22. Switch74
    Switch74's post in Навигация со скролом для мобильной версии сайта was marked as the answer   
    @media (max-width: 700px){     nav {         position: static;         overflow: scroll;         white-space: nowrap;    } } и что не так?
    Я бы начиная с 1000 уже эти правила вводил, а то у вас там меню уже переноситься начинает
  23. Switch74
    Switch74's post in Плавающее боковое меню дергается при скроле вниз was marked as the answer   
    попробуйте использовать данный скрипт в идеальных условиях и добавляйте в них потихоньку свои скрипты и модули, так найдете с чем конфликтует скрипт. Еще это может быть css который влияет на плавающее меню.
    Т.к. скрипт в идеальных условиях в демо работает норм, скорее всего он именно с чем-то конфликтует.
    На данный момент у вас скрипт через раз определяет правильную высоту плавающего блока из-за чего и скачет.
    Я вижу у вас есть информация, которая грузится через js в плавающий блок, возможно она влияет на это.
    Еще бывает такой момент: когда сайт перегружен скриптами и они все отрабатывают на одно и то же событие, на это тратится время, что приводит к задержке отработки последних скриптов и как результат они могут отрабатывать с задержкой.
  24. Switch74
    Switch74's post in Не работает denwer was marked as the answer   
    я бы посоветовал использовать openserver или использовать какой-нибудь бесплатный хостинг
  25. Switch74
    Switch74's post in Тонкости cursor: url was marked as the answer   
    В Gecko (Firefox) максимальный размер курсора - 128×128 пикселей. Изображения большего размера игнорируются. Однако, вам следую ограничиться рамером курсора в 32×32 пикселя для максимальной совместимости с операционными системами и платформами.
    про другие браузеры можно так же найти в интернете информацию
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ue. See more about our Guidelines and Privacy Policy